Distance

The distance between Osaka International Airport (ITM) and Arimaonsen Station is approximately 40 kilometers (25 miles).

How to Reach

There are several ways to reach Arimaonsen Station from Osaka International Airport (ITM):

  • By train: The fastest and most convenient way to reach Arimaonsen Station from Osaka International Airport (ITM) is by train. The journey takes approximately 60 minutes and costs around 1,500 yen (one way).
  • By bus: There are also several bus services that operate between Osaka International Airport (ITM) and Arimaonsen Station. The journey takes approximately 90 minutes and costs around 1,000 yen (one way).
  • By taxi: Taxis are available outside Osaka International Airport (ITM). The journey takes approximately 60 minutes and costs around 6,000 yen (one way).

Best time to go

The best time to visit Arimaonsen is during the spring (March to May) or autumn (September to November) when the weather is mild and pleasant. However, Arimaonsen is also a popular destination during the winter months (December to February) when you can enjoy the snow-covered scenery.
